Output 376268547ba83a06a42cbd2860f67bd5f16228b786b0c1d754ba012a7de8d12e:2

value
999772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830491c914bc2e13834ad0e5688b7fc941124a90 OP_EQUAL
address
3DdmvAbKxBhWKhoKa8LSZTDUXJpqneNete
transaction
376268547ba83a06a42cbd2860f67bd5f16228b786b0c1d754ba012a7de8d12e
spent
true